Sanson (cycling team, 1969)
Sanson was an Italian professional cycling team that existed for only the 1969 season.[1][2] The team was one of several professional cycling teams throughout the 1960s and 1970s that were sponsored by Sanson Gelati, an Italian food producer.

Major wins
- Overall Tirreno–Adriatico, Carlo Chiappano
- Milano–Vignola, Attilio Rota
- Escalada a Montjuïc, Gianni Motta
- Giro dell'Emilia, Gianni Motta
- Stage 10 Giro d'Italia, Carlo Chiappano
